**Alert: InvoiceForge PDF Renderer Failure**

Fires when the Quillbatch renderer fails three consecutive invoice jobs. Usually a corrupt font cache or a malformed template from the Ledgerline upload path. Restart the renderer pod first; if failures persist, quarantine the offending template ID from the alert payload. If the queue keeps backing up after restart, escalate immediately.

pager mailbox: druwyn@norvaio.corp

**Q: Why does LiftSim's dispatch queue use a custom heap instead of the standard library?**

The stdlib heap reorders equal-priority hall calls, which breaks determinism in replay tests. Our heap is insertion-stable. Don't "simplify" it during review — the replay suite will fail silently on some seeds. See `docs/determinism.md` for the full rationale. Questions about the heap invariants go to the sim-core maintainer.

escalation mailbox, hahog-yahop: wenox.ralix.ralax@qirvandata.local

## Service Account: Partner SFTP Drop

The `ferrow-drop` account pulls nightly files from the Quarle partner SFTP into Bramleyfeed. Files land under `/incoming/quarle/`; checksums verify automatically. Never upload manually. Polling runs every 20 minutes via the Hollis scheduler, which authenticates to the ingest API with the key below.

gateway credential: kto23_dolYgAScEh2TaPOlStqOl98

Subject: Partner SFTP drop — new owner

Hi,

As you review the pending changes to the Harborline ingest scripts, note that ownership of the partner SFTP drop is changing at the end of the month. This includes key rotation, the nightly pull job, and the quarantine folder for malformed files. Review comments on the retry logic should still go through the normal PR flow, but questions about drop-folder conventions or partner onboarding now go to the new owner. The incoming owner is listed below.

signatory, tagaf-bahaf: Praael Fenmir Rusok